Uecko_ERP/modules/auth/src/web/auth-routes.tsx

28 lines
619 B
TypeScript
Raw Normal View History

2025-05-28 14:21:09 +00:00
import { ModuleClientParams } from "@erp/core/client";
2025-05-29 11:15:28 +00:00
import { Outlet, RouteObject } from "react-router-dom";
import { AuthLayout } from "./components";
2025-05-28 14:21:09 +00:00
import { LoginPage } from "./pages";
export const AuthRoutes = (params: ModuleClientParams): RouteObject[] => {
return [
{
2025-05-29 11:15:28 +00:00
path: "*",
element: (
<AuthLayout>
<Outlet context={params} />
</AuthLayout>
),
children: [
{
path: "login",
element: <LoginPage />,
},
{
path: "register",
element: <div>Register</div>,
},
],
2025-05-28 14:21:09 +00:00
},
];
};